Ingredients

Delicious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read recipe with step-by-step instructions.

For the Batter

  • 3 ripe bananas, mashed (about 1 1/2 cups)
  • 2/3 cup canned pumpkin
  • 1 large egg, at room temperature
  • 5 tbsp melted butter, cooled
  • 1/3 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 tsp sea salt
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 1/2 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• 1/2 to 1 tsp pumpkin pie spice, optional
  • 1 cup dark chocolate chips, divided (3/4 cup for batter, 1/4 cup for topping)

How to Make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a bread pan thoroughly or line it with parchment paper to make removal easier.

Step 2: Prepare the Wet Ingredients

In a medium bowl:
Mash the ripe bananas until smooth.
Add in the egg and whisk together until combined.
Mix in cooled melted butter, vanilla extract, canned pumpkin, and brown sugar until smooth.

Step 3: Combine Dry Ingredients

In another bowl:
Whisk together all-purpose flour, sea salt, baking soda, and baking powder.
If using pumpkin pie spice, add it at this stage for even distribution.

Step 4: Mix Wet and Dry Ingredients

Pour the dry ingredient mixture into the bowl with wet ingredients.
Stir gently until just combined; avoid overmixing to keep your bread light.

Step 5: Add Chocolate Chips

Fold in 3/4 cup of dark chocolate chips carefully.
Pour the batter into the prepared pan and sprinkle remaining chocolate chips on top to enhance presentation.

Step 6: Bake Your Bread

Place your pan in the preheated oven:
Bake for about 50–60 minutes.
To check if it’s done, insert a toothpick into the center—if it comes out clean, it’s ready!
If browning too quickly on top, tent loosely with foil during baking.

Allow cooling before removing from the pan. For best results, let it cool completely before slicing!

How to Perfect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read

To ensure your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read turns out perfectly every time, consider these useful tips.

  • Use ripe bananas: Ripe bananas have more natural sweetness, resulting in a moist and flavorful bread.
  • Don’t overmix: Mix just until combined to keep the texture light and fluffy—overmixing can lead to density.
  • Cool melted butter: Letting melted butter cool prevents scrambling the egg when mixed into the batter.
  • Add nuts for crunch: Consider folding in walnuts or pecans for an added crunch that complements the chocolate.
  • Bake evenly: Rotate your pan halfway through baking to ensure even cooking and browning on all sides.
  • Store properly: Wrap leftovers tightly in plastic wrap to maintain moisture and freshness for several days.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Making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read is simple, but there are a few common mistakes that can affect the final result. Here’s how to avoid them.

  • Using Overripe Bananas: While ripe bananas add sweetness, overly brown bananas can alter the texture and flavor. Aim for bananas that are ripe but not blackened.
  • Not Measuring Ingredients Accurately: Baking is a science, and imprecise measurements can lead to dense bread. Always use measuring cups and spoons for accuracy.
  • Overmixing the Batter: Mixing too much can make the bread tough. Combine wet and dry ingredients until just mixed for a light texture.
  • Ignoring Oven Temperature: Each oven varies, so keep an eye on your bread as it bakes. Use an oven thermometer if necessary to ensure accurate temperature.
  • Skipping Cooling Time: Cutting into the bread too soon can make it gummy. Allow it to cool completely in the pan before slicing for the best texture.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store leftover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
  • Wrap individual slices in plastic wrap for easy grab-and-go snacks.

Freezing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read

  • Place the cooled bread in a freezer-safe bag, removing as much air as possible. It can last up to 3 months in the freezer.
  • For best results, slice the bread before freezing for quick thawing.

Reheating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read

  • O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C). Wrap the bread in foil and heat for about 10-15 minutes until warm.
  • Microwave: Heat individual slices on medium power for 20-30 seconds or until warm.
  • Stovetop: Place slices in a skillet over low heat, cover, and heat for about 2-3 minutes on each side.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some frequently asked questions about making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read.

Can I use fresh pumpkin instead of canned?

Yes, you can use fresh pumpkin puree instead of canned. Just ensure it is well-drained to avoid excess moisture.

How do I know when my Sweet Pumpkin Banana Chocolate Chip Bread is done?

Insert a toothpick into the center of the bread; if it comes out clean or with a few crumbs, it’s ready!

Can I substitute chocolate chips with nuts?

Absolutely! Feel free to replace chocolate chips with nuts or dried fruit for a different flavor profile.

Is this recipe suitable for vegan diets?

You can make this recipe vegan by substituting the egg with flaxseed meal or applesauce and using dairy-free butter.
